Sensory Information
Data received by the senses (sight, smell, touch, taste, and hearing) that is processed by the brain.
Perception
The process by which organisms interpret and organize sensory information to produce a meaningful experience of the world.
Motion Sickness
A condition in which the discrepancy between visually perceived movement and the vestibular system's sense of movement causes nausea, dizziness, and other symptoms.
